Why People Are Moving to San Antonio 

Over the past decade, San Antonio has consistently ranked among the top U.S. cities for population growth. The city's appeal comes down to a few key factors: 

A strong and diverse job market — major employers include USAA, H-E-B, Valero Energy, Rackspace, and a robust military presence anchored by Joint Base San Antonio 

No state income tax in Texas, which translates to real take-home pay advantages 

A cost of living that remains below the national average even as the city grows 

A thriving food, arts, and culture scene centered around destinations like the Pearl District and the River Walk 

Warm weather nearly year-round with more than 220 sunny days annually 

Understanding San Antonio's Neighborhoods 

San Antonio is a large city — nearly 500 square miles — so understanding the different areas before you commit to a lease is important. Here's a quick breakdown of some popular zones: 

North San Antonio / Stone Oak: Suburban, family-friendly, great schools, close to major employers. A popular choice for professionals and families. 

Alamo Heights / Terrell Hills: Upscale historic neighborhood with tree-lined streets and a tight-knit community feel. 

Downtown / Southtown: Urban energy, walkable, rich in restaurants and nightlife. Great for young professionals.

What to Expect Weather-Wise 

San Antonio winters are mild — temperatures rarely dip below freezing for long — but summers are hot. June through August regularly sees highs in the mid-90s to 100°F range. Here are a few things new residents should know: 

Invest in blackout curtains or thermal blinds to keep your apartment cool 

Your electric bill will climb in summer — CPS Energy is the local utility provider; budget accordingly 

Take advantage of early mornings and evenings for outdoor activities 

San Antonio is no stranger to sudden heavy rain events — keep a rain jacket handy 

Getting Around San Antonio 

San Antonio is primarily a car-dependent city. While there is a VIA Metropolitan Transit bus network, most residents drive. Here are some commute and navigation tips: 

IH-10, IH-35, Loop 1604, and US-281 are the major arterials — learn their interchange patterns early 

Traffic peaks between 7–9 AM and 4:30–6:30 PM on weekdays

Getting Your Texas Essentials Set Up 

Once you arrive, there are a few administrative items to take care of: 

Driver's license: Visit a Texas DPS office within 90 days of establishing residency. 

Vehicle registration: Must be completed within 30 days of moving. You'll need proof of insurance, a valid inspection, and your out-of-state title. 

Voter registration: Texas allows online voter registration — visit VoteTexas.gov

Utilities: CPS Energy is the primary electricity provider in San Antonio. Set up service before your move-in date.
